As a Lab Technician I you will…
At the BASF ECMS Huntsville plant, we make the chemistry and technology used in vehicle catalytic convertors and other environmental products. As part of our team, employees help us conceive, design, implement, and validate new equipment, technologies, and processes to help make our world's environment cleaner. Our Quality Control Department plays a vital role in the success of our plant. This position contributes by performing laboratory tests to determine chemical and physical characteristics of in-process samples and final products in support of production around the site.
In this role you will
- Operates ALL laboratory equipment and instruments such as agitators, rheometers, analytical balances, high temperature ovens, pH meters, LECO solids analyzers, XRF, BET, and CAEF Reactors.
- Ability to perform ALL laboratory job functions.
- Responsible for training in preparation and testing of in-process and/or final product samples by a variety of analytical techniques and instrumentation.
- Adheres to company policies, procedures, and work instructions regarding proper sample handling, preparation, and testing in support of company’s safety, environmental, and production objectives.
- Coordinates and participates in routine validation studies (MSA) to replicate and verify results with industry or scientific literature standards.
- Utilization of instrument and data acquisition software to report analytical results.
- Ability to perform general calibration and maintenance work on lab equipment.
- Ability to facilitate Management of Change (MOC), special projects, Measurement Systems Analysis (MSA), and lead other projects as assigned.
- Ability to train, lead, and coordinate the work of lab technicians.

About BASF Environmental Catalysts and Metal Solutions
Leveraging its deep expertise as the global leader in catalysis and precious metals, BASF Environmental Catalysts and Metal Solutions (ECMS) serves customers in many industries including automotive, aerospace, indoor air quality, semiconductors, and hydrogen economy, and provides full loop services with its precious metals trading and recycling offering. With a focus on circular solutions and sustainability, ECMS is committed to helping our customers create a cleaner, more sustainable world. Protecting our elements of life is our purpose and this inspires us to ever-new solutions.
ECMS operates globally in 15 countries with approximately 20 production sites and over 4,000 employees.
